**Q: PickPather is generating weird zig-zag routes — is it broken?**

Probably not. PickPather falls back to naive aisle ordering when the bin-location cache is cold, usually after a redeploy. Give it ten minutes; if routes stay ugly, warm the cache manually. The cache-warming steps are written up on the internal page.

runbook for tajep-yahig: https://artifactory.lumictech.corp/repo

Team,

The cut-over of the Markprint rendering pipeline finished Tuesday night with no rollback needed. All tenant traffic now flows through the new renderer; the legacy parser remains in read-only fallback for two more weeks while we monitor diff rates, which are currently under 0.02%. Footnote handling and nested table edge cases were the main sources of diffs, both now patched. Caching behavior changed slightly, so please skim the settings below. The production configuration at cut-over time was the following.

config for yahop-tafof:
[rusir]
port = 11211
region = upper-1
host = rusir.torvacloud.test
team = ulaax
timeout_ms = 1500
retries = 8

### Sweepling 2.4.0 — Key Rotation Notice

The orphaned-resource sweeper now signs all plugin-facing manifests with a rotated key, effective this release. Plugin authors must update their verification configuration before the old key expires in 30 days; manifests verified against the retired key will be rejected. The new public signing key is provided below.

signing key of bagap-yawep = bky13_TbfT6ZMUoGJo2

# Constants for the Rindlehaus orphan sweeper.
# Covered in this week's eng sync: the sweeper now batches deletions
# and respects a per-tenant quota so one noisy tenant can't starve
# the others. Grace periods were lengthened after the Febuary incident
# review. Current tuning constants are defined immediately below.

constants for bagaf-hadup:
QUOTAS = {
    "quenael": 1,
    "ralwyn": 1,
    "oliath": 2,
    "ulaael": 2,
}